Warning Signs You Need Contaminated Water Removal

Catching contaminated water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ent health risks to you and your family.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ant Odors can be a sign of mold growth or bacterial contamination. If you’ve noticed a musty smell in your home that persists despite cleaning and ventilation, it’s time to call us.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Visible Water Stains can show water damage or leaks. If you’ve noticed water stains on your ceilings or walls, it’s essential to investigate the source of the problem and take action quickly.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or Buckled Flooring can be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ture. If your flooring is showing signs of warping or buckling, it’s time to call us for an assessment.

Unexplained Health Issues

Unexplained Health Issues can be linked to contaminated water or mold growth. If you or a family member is experiencing unexplained health issues, such as respiratory problems or skin irritation, it’s essential to investigate the source of the problem.

Excessive Moisture in Basements or Attics

Excessive Moisture in basements or attics can lead to mold growth, water damage, and structural issues. If you’ve noticed excessive moisture in these areas, it’s time to call us for an assessment.

Leaking Appliances or Fixtures

Leaking Appliances or Fixtures can cause water damage and contamination. If you’ve noticed leaks from your appliances or fixtures, it’s essential to investigate the source of the problem and take action quickly.

Contaminated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Pro

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small Water Leak with Minimal Damage Yes No DIY repairs are usually safe and effective for small water leaks with minimal damage.
Standing Water with Visible Mold Growth No Yes Standing water with visible mold growth need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ove and prevent further damage.
Water Damage with Structural Issues No Yes Water damage with structural issues needs the expertise of a professional to assess and repair the damage safely and effectively.
Excessive Moisture in Basements or Attics No Yes Excessive moisture in basements or attics need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ove and prevent further damage.

Contaminated Water Removal Cost in Oakton, VA

The cost of contaminated water removal in Oakton, VA,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the scope of the project. Here are some estimated costs for specific services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$300 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Restoration and Reconstruction $2,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age

Common Questions About Contaminated Water Removal

Q: What is contaminated water removal?

A: Contaminated water removal is the process of safely removing water that has been contaminated with bacteria, fungi, or other microorganisms. Our team uses specialized equipment and expertise to extract the water and dry the affected area.

Q: How long does contaminated water removal take?

A: The length of time it takes to complete contaminated water removal dep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team typically completes the process within 3-5 days.

Q: Is contaminated water removal covered by insurance?

A: Yes, contaminated water removal is often covered by insurance. We work with your insurance provider to ensure that you receive the maximum coverage for your claim.

Q: Can I prevent contaminated water damage?

A: Yes, you can prevent contaminated water damage by regularly inspecting your home for signs of water damage, fixing leaks quickly, and maintaining your plumbing and HVAC systems.
